码率,即视频或音频数据的传输速率,是衡量数字媒体质量的重要指标。它直接关系到视频的清晰度和音频的保真度。码率究竟如何计算呢?下面,我们就来一步步揭开这个问题的面纱。
一、码率的基本概念
1.码率(itrate)是指单位时间内传输或存储的数据量,通常以比特每秒(s)或兆比特每秒(Ms)来表示。
2.码率越高,视频或音频的传输或存储效率越高,但同时也会占用更多的带宽和存储空间。二、计算码率的公式
1.码率=数据量/时间
2.对于视频或音频文件,数据量可以通过以下公式计算:
数据量=视频分辨率×帧率×每帧像素数×每像素位数+音频采样率×采样位数三、具体计算步骤
1.确定视频分辨率:例如1920x1080像素。
2.确定帧率:例如30帧每秒。
3.确定每帧像素数:视频分辨率中的像素数,即1920x1080。
4.确定每像素位数:例如8位(256色)。
5.确定音频采样率:例如44.1kHz。
6.确定采样位数:例如16位。四、实例计算 以一个1920x1080分辨率的视频为例,帧率为30fs,每帧像素数为1920x1080,每像素位数为8位,音频采样率为44.1kHz,采样位数为16位。
码率=(1920x1080x8+44.1kHzx16)/1秒
码率=(2073600+704)/1
码率=2079360s
码率=2.07936Ms五、码率调整
1.根据实际需求调整码率,例如降低码率以适应带宽限制或提高传输速度。
2.调整视频分辨率、帧率、每帧像素数等参数来改变码率。 码率的计算涉及到多个参数,需要根据实际需求进行调整。通过掌握码率计算方法,我们可以更好地了解视频和音频的质量,以及如何优化传输和存储效率。希望**能帮助您解决“码率怎么算”的问题。1.本站遵循行业规范,任何转载的稿件都会明确标注作者和来源;
2.本站的原创文章,请转载时务必注明文章作者和来源,不尊重原创的行为我们将追究责任;
3.作者投稿可能会经我们编辑修改或补充。